Default Southern California club

Hey there,

Although new to this forum, I formally invite all Chevelle/Camino owners out to our bi-monthly gathering in Anaheim every 1st and 3rd Fridays of the month. It's an all make/model meet that we hold at K1 Speed in Anaheim. It's for gear heads of all kinds. We don't discriminate if Fords or Dodges come out It starts at 7pm and lasts til the last guy/gal leaves. We also hold Tech Days and other fun stuff. Feel free to come out!!
